The Nearby Supernova Factory II (http://snfactory.lbl.gov) reports the following spectroscopic observations of supernovae based on spectra (range 320-1000 nm) obtained with the SuperNova Integral Field Spectrograph (Aldering et al 2002, SPIE, 4836, 61) on the University of Hawaii 2.2-meter telescope. Classifications were performed using SNID (Blondin & Tonry, 2007, ApJ, 666, 1024). Heliocentric redshifts listed to two decimal places are measured from supernova features; all others are published values or measured by us from host galaxy features.
